SPOT
features four key functions that enable users to send messages to friends,
family or emergency responders, based upon varying levels
of need:
Alert 9-1-1 – Dispatch emergency
responders to your exact location. SPOT sends one message every 5 minutes
until power is depleted or 911 is cancelled.
Ask for Help – Request help from
friends and family in your exact location. SPOT sends one message every
5 minutes for one hour or until Help is cancelled.
Check In – Let contacts know where
you are and that you’re
okay. SPOT sends three identical messages to the SPOT service for redundancy.
The first of those three messages is delivered.
Track Progress – Send and save your
location and allow contacts to track your progress using Google Maps™. SPOT
sends one message every 10 minutes for 24 hours or until SPOT is powered
off.
COVERAGE
SPOT works around the world, including virtually all of North America,
South America, Europe and Australia, Northern Africa and Northeastern
Asia, and hundreds or thousands of miles offshore of these areas.
BATTERY
LIFE
Includes
2 AA lithium batteries; under normal usage a full battery charge should
meet or exceed the following:
• Power on, unused: Approx. 1 year
• SPOTcasting tracking mode: Approx. 14 days
• 9-1-1 mode: Up to 7 consecutive days
• SPOTcheck OK/√: 1900 messages
OPERATING CONDITIONS
•
Operating Temperatures: -40 degrees F to +185 degrees F
• Operating Altitude: -300ft
to +21,000ft
• Floats in water
• Waterproof to 1 meter for up to 30 minutes
• Humidity Rated - MIL_STD-810E
Method 507.3, 95% to 100% condensing
Salt Fog Rated - Per MIL_STD 810E Method 509.3, 5% NaCl, 95% distilled
water
• Drop Test- Dropped twice on al six sides from one meter onto hard
surface.
CERTIFICATIONS
•
OSHA certified Intrinsically Safe to Class 1, Division 1, Group A-D
• ROHS and WEEE compliant.
• Certified to FCC and CE emissions, immunity and safety regulation.
• Meets FCC part 25 regulation, Canada type approval, CISPR Publiation
22 (1985 1st Edition), RTTE Directive (1999/EC), IEC 60950 safety standard,
and European EMC Directive 89/336/EEC
